Bodrum Castle, also known as the Castle of St. Peter, is located in Bodrum, Turkey. Built by the Knights Hospitaller in the early 15th century, it stands as a remarkable example of medieval architecture. The castle overlooks the harbor and offers panoramic views of the surrounding area. Inside, you will find the Museum of Underwater Archaeology, which showcases artifacts from shipwrecks found in the Aegean Sea.

Visitors are encouraged to check Bodrum Castle opening hours before planning their visit, as they may vary seasonally. The site provides an insightful glimpse into the regions historical significance and maritime history. Additionally, the castle grounds include several towers and courtyards to explore, each with its unique features. It’s an ideal spot for those interested in history and architecture.
